Skydance Media has acquired the animation unit of Madrid-based Ilion Studios. The new entity will be rechristened Skydance Animation Madrid. The companies had been working together for some time. IFC Films has nabbed U.S. rights to “Tesla,” the story of inventor Nikola Tesla and his efforts to build a revolutionary electrical system. Actress and singer Rita Wilson has teamed up with veteran hip-hop act Naughty By Nature for a remix of the group’s 1992 classic “Hip Hop Hooray,” via Tommy Boy Music, and available exclusively on YouTube today. The single will be released widely on all digital/streaming platforms this Friday, April 10, with profits from the recording will be donated to the MusiCares Foundation

Former NENT Studios U.K. boss Jakob Mejlhede Andersen has been appointed CCO of Shahid, the streaming service operated by the Middle East Broadcasting Centre (MBC) which was just revamped. Andersen will be responsible for the overall content strategy for both Shahid and its premium offering, Shahid VIP, and will be banking on original content, exclusive premieres, and popular third-party programming in Arabic and other languages. Thai film maker Thanakorn Pongsuwan, best known for 2009 film “Fireball,” died on Friday. He was 46. His death was not caused by the coronavirus outbreak, though his last rites will be affected.
